Maryland: the school districts with the most multiracial students

24 districts

Maryland public school districts ranked by the total number of students of two or more races enrolled, from federal NCES data. Districts need at least 2 schools and 500 students to qualify.

#DistrictStateSchoolsStudents% Two or moreMultiracial students
1Montgomery County Public SchoolsMD208159,1815.4%8,529
2Baltimore County Public SchoolsMD177110,8725.4%5,946
3Anne Arundel County Public SchoolsMD12585,0296.6%5,620
4Howard County Public SchoolsMD7757,5657.0%4,020
5Frederick County Public SchoolsMD6748,0547.5%3,624
6Harford County Public SchoolsMD5537,7717.8%2,956
7Charles County Public SchoolsMD3828,1628.0%2,262
8Washington County Public SchoolsMD4323,3209.3%2,166
9Prince George's County Public SchoolsMD199132,6931.4%1,885
10St. Mary's County Public SchoolsMD2616,9059.3%1,572
11Calvert County Public SchoolsMD2414,84910.5%1,553
12Baltimore City Public SchoolsMD15276,9462.0%1,513
13Wicomico County Public SchoolsMD2515,5828.0%1,254
14Cecil County Public SchoolsMD2814,8538.4%1,242
15Carroll County Public SchoolsMD4326,1414.3%1,120
16Allegany County Public SchoolsMD228,1137.8%634
17Worcester County Public SchoolsMD137,0028.0%561
18Caroline County Public SchoolsMD95,6488.9%503
19Queen Anne's County Public SchoolsMD147,4786.4%477
20Dorchester County Public SchoolsMD114,5867.8%357
21Talbot County Public SchoolsMD84,4856.1%275
22Somerset County Public SchoolsMD72,9019.2%267
23Kent County Public SchoolsMD51,6949.0%152
24Garrett County Public SchoolsMD123,8532.4%94
